Your role and work environment 

ING’s Payments and Settlement Services (“PSS”) aims to further mature, develop and expand ING’s state of the art payments platforms and services. The PSS will focus on delivering payments and settlement services, meeting the expectations of ING’s business lines and beyond, whilst ensuring the basics: safe, secure, compliant and reliable. PSS is an independent unit, combining Tech, Products and Operations functions. The Business Unit is positioned within ING’s COO domain, reporting directly into ING’s Chief Operations Officer.  

The PSS is responsible for providing standardized payments and settlement services to multiple ING business lines globally (both Wholesale and Retail). With an ambition to also look for external commercialization of our payment platforms our service & contract management practice needs to be in perfect condition, consuming and providing services in a highly transparent manner.

Within the PSS, the Contract & Service Management team consists of two Contract & Service Managers (one located in Amsterdam, one located in Hubs) who manage the contracts and service agreements between the Payments Utility and its clients and providers (both Internal and External). Responsibilities

As a Contract & Service Manager you:   

  • Have a shared responsibility for defining the services offered towards the (internal) clients, including aggregating all components required and placing them into a gateway. 

  • Ensure the financial setup (incoming and outgoing) meets the gateway requirements, and is setup in a cost-effective manner. 

  • Have a shared responsibility for developing, maintaining the contracts and service level agreement for services delivered by the PSS towards its clients. 

  • Provide expertise and support throughout the whole lifecycle of the contract. 

  • Are responsible for ensuring contracts in your portfolio are properly embedded and aligned with relevant internal stakeholders, like Finance and Legal. 

  • Are able to interpret and apply key financial indicators to improve the contract and service agreements in place 

  • Are responsible for service management activities for the contracts in your portfolio, including periodic service review meetings and reporting on agreed KPI’s. 

  • Are responsible for delivering an In Control Statement on the services delivered, towards the internal clients 

  • Act as the day to day point of contact for your (internal) clients. 

  • Act as a point of escalation, in case of disputes for the contracts in your portfolio.
